ISRO successfully conducted the second Integrated Air Drop Test (IADT-02) for the Gaganyaan mission at Satish Dhawan Space Centre, Sriharikota
-
Test details: A simulated Crew Module weighing ~5.7 tonnes (equivalent to actual G1 mission Crew Module mass) was lifted by Indian Air Force Chinook helicopter to ~3 km altitude and released over a designated sea drop zone near Sriharikota coast
-
Purpose of IADT: Tests the parachute and flotation systems of the Crew Module โ critical for safe recovery of astronauts after splashdown in the sea
-
Gaganyaan mission overview: India's first human spaceflight programme; G1 is the first uncrewed test mission; ISRO has not yet announced firm dates for G1 launch
-
Significance of IADT-02: Marked a significant step in readiness for the G1 mission; validates that crew recovery systems work at correct mass and altitude parameters
-
Leh angle: Preparations also involve high-altitude training at Leh for astronaut physiological conditioning; crew training ongoing at multiple ISRO and IAF facilities
-
Broader context: Gaganyaan is a critical milestone for India's space programme; success will make India the 4th country to send humans to space (after USSR/Russia, USA, China); part of ISRO's vision to build an Indian Space Station by 2035 and send Indians to Moon by 2040

Gaganyaan: India's human spaceflight programme; crew of 3 to orbit Earth at 400 km altitude for 3 days
-
IADT-02 (Integrated Air Drop Test): tests parachute and recovery systems; conducted at SDSC, Sriharikota
-
Chinook helicopter: heavy-lift helicopter; operated by Indian Air Force; used for high-altitude logistics and now astronaut recovery testing
-
Countries with human spaceflight capability: USSR/Russia (1961), USA (1961), China (2003); India (Gaganyaan โ pending)
-
Satish Dhawan Space Centre (SDSC): ISRO's primary launch facility; located at Sriharikota, Andhra Pradesh
๐ Key Term: Gaganyaan โ India's first indigenous human spaceflight mission by ISRO; aims to send a 3-member crew to Low Earth Orbit (400 km) for 3 days; G1 is the uncrewed demonstration flight.
